South Canterbury Cricket Association is looking to promote the female game in the district by creating a modified competition for all interested females to play.

The competition will be called “Women’s Quick Smash”. It will played on Monday nights starting on the 6th November from 5.30-7pm (90 mins only).

It will be played with an “incrediball” which while still solid is nowhere near as hard as a cricket ball, thus eliminating the need to wear pads, helmets gloves etc.

  • Teams will be 8-a-side, and everybody will bat for the same amount of time (3 overs per pair).
  • If you get out you keep on batting, you just lose some runs off your total.
  • It will be 12 overs per side, with bowlers bowling from one end only.

There is no cost to enter and it is open to all females from primary through to adults. Schools are encouraged to enter teams and clubs as well.
